Ep 343: Emotional Eating with Amber Romaniuk
Hi Friends,
Joining me today is Amber Romaniuk, an Emotional Eating, Digestive and Hormone Expert and host of “The No Sugarcoating Podcast” . I invited her on the show to talk about the parallels between people’s relationship with clutter, organization, and food.
Amber shares her own story of weight gain, binge eating and the shame that comes with it. Her honesty and vulnerability, talking about her own “rock bottom” moment, and how she finally found a path to healing.
As I listened to her story, I was reminded of clients, and even friends, who have looked at me and asked “why can’t I let go of this?’ or “why do I keep buying things even though I don’t need them?”
During our conversation we talked about:
- The importance of understanding your emotional TRIGGERS
- The difference between PHYSICAL & EMOTIONAL hunger
- Being VULNERABLE enough to ask for help
- We also touched on hormonal IMBALANCES for my fellow sisters in menopause
Similarly to clutter, our eating habits are developed over years and change takes time and intentionality, but committing to changing unhealthy behaviors is the first step.
Whether you are someone who struggles with emotional eating or clutter, this is a great conversation worth the listen. If you know someone who can benefit from this episode, please share it with a friend!
